Designing Your Weekly Checklist

A great routine lives on paper before it lives in your calendar. Build a simple, ordered checklist that covers communications, finances, planning, and digital hygiene. Keep it visible, printable, and short enough to finish comfortably, yet thorough enough to prevent surprise fires later in the week.

Protecting the Time Slot

Consistency beats intensity. Choose a recurring, realistic time when interruptions are rare, then defend it like an important appointment. Add reminders, block notifications, inform colleagues, and keep a visible boundary. Missing a week is a detour, not defeat; reschedule immediately and begin again.

Tools That Keep It Simple

Use the lightest possible setup that reduces friction. A timer, a single list, and a consolidated dashboard beat a maze of apps. Automations handle repetition, filters surface the actionable, and templates prevent re-typing. Everything serves momentum, not novelty or complicated digital tinkering.

Timer, Playlist, and Atmosphere

Rituals reinforce start lines. A dedicated playlist, a visible countdown, and a cleared desk switch your brain into execution mode. Keep water nearby, close extra tabs, and set phones face-down. Environmental cues remove excuses and amplify a feeling of determined, focused progress.

Automation Rules That Pay Rent

Create email filters, canned responses, and file-naming templates. Route receipts automatically, label newsletters, and batch low-importance items. Small automations repay setup time every single week, compounding into hours saved each quarter and a calmer baseline you can feel during busy seasons.

One Dashboard To Rule The Noise

Centralize everything: inbox, tasks flagged during the sweep, calendar view, and a short checklist. Avoid switching tools mid-sprint. A single pane reduces hesitation, keeps priorities visible, and helps you finish the hour feeling complete rather than scattered across five disconnected places.

Measure What Matters

Start tiny: mark a checkbox for completed sessions, count backlog items cleared, and note one avoided crisis. Optional extras include inbox size delta, bill status, and time spent. Use trends, not perfection, to steer improvements and reward progress that genuinely lightens your week.

Rewards and Storytelling

Pair the hour with a small reward: a walk, a cappuccino, or a song you love. Share before-and-after snapshots with your team or friends. Turning maintenance into a story multiplies motivation and invites camaraderie, accountability, and helpful ideas from others walking the same path.
